    Abstract: An upper-completion single trip system is described which includes a hydraulic internal seal receptacle assemble. The HISR assembly includes an overshot assembly selectively connected to a mandrel assembly. Once fully actuated, relative axial motion therebetween is allowed, which provides a spacer apparatus for the tubing above and below the HISR assembly. A shearable anchor latch as well as an indexing mule shoe are also provided in the HISR system, which allow multiple completion steps to be performed in a single trip. The HISR system is particularly well-suited for installation of permanent downhole gauges or intelligent systems—installations where rotation of pipe is prohibited. The system is also particularly well-suited for submersible pumps. A method of performing multiple completion activities in a single trip is also described.

    Abstract: A well logging tool includes a conductive mandrel; an antenna array disposed around the conductive mandrel, wherein the antenna array comprises a plurality of antennas disposed on insulating supports and at least one contact spacer, the at least one contact spacer having at least one conductor channel having a contact assembly disposed therein; and a sleeve disposed over the antenna array, wherein the sleeve includes at least one electrode, the at least one electrode and the contact assembly adapted to provide a radially conductive path from an exterior of the well logging tool to the conductive mandrel.

    Abstract: Shield apparatus are provided for use with logging instruments equipped with transverse magnetic dipole antennas. Flexible dielectric strips and dielectric cylindrical bodies are implemented with conductive elements in various patterns to form Faraday shield structures. The shields provide an extended conductive surface to the instrument support member and redirect axial currents along the borehole, protecting the underlying antennas from the undesired effects of these currents.
